American Jazz Museum

The American Jazz Museum is Kansas City's jazz museum that focuses on the history and music of American jazz. Its displays include works by artists such as Duke Ellington (Louis Armstrong), Ella Fitzgerald, Charlie Parker, and others. The museum's aim is to make American jazz history more accessible.

The American Jazz Museum can be found in the historic 18th and Vine Jazz district. It offers interactive exhibits, films and a changing gallery. A 500-seat performing art center hosts live performances. Federal holidays mean that the museum is closed. The Blue Room hosts weekly jams. The Blue Room also hosts a Latin Jazz/Salsa series monthly.

Kansas City's American Jazz Museum is an excellent place for jazz fans and history buffs. It showcases the history of African American musicians and restaurateurs in the city’s music scene. It promotes jazz education as well as research. The American Jazz Museum Kansas City recognizes African Americans' music and contributes to American culture.

The Kansas City Jazz Museum celebrates American jazz history through interactive exhibits, educational programming, and a functioning jazz club. The museum, which is located in Kansas City's 18th and Vine Historic Jazz Districts, focuses on the musical and cultural explosion that took place in Kansas City during 1920s and 30s. It is also home to a 500-seat performance area and is an affiliate of Smithsonian.

Loose Garden

Loose Park in Kansas City is the perfect place to get out and enjoy the great outdoors. The 3.1 mile trail has an elevation gain in excess of 187 feet. It is rated easy. Pay attention to the amount of traffic through the park and on the trail. Officials recommend that you do not use playground equipment during crowds.

It covers 75 acres and is close to the Plaza. It includes a playground and walking paths as well as tennis courts, rose gardens, and Civil War markers. The park also features a picnic area as well as a Japanese Tea House. Visitors can also enjoy watching the brave squirrels, among other things.

The city's municipal rosegarden is located in the rose garden. It was established in 1931 by Laura Conyers Smith and now has more than 3,000 roses in 130 varieties. A $400,000 renovation project has restored the rose beds back to their original plans. Additionally, 1,200 roses were added.

The large pond is south of the garden center. There is a metal box in the center that can hold park information. Two large meeting rooms are available at the garden center, each with attached small kitchens. The park also has a horticultural library that is open from Monday to Friday.

Loose park's pond is another attraction. It is often inhabited by ducks, and is popular for taking photos. The park's size is 75 acres. That is equal to 57 football courts. This makes it the largest park in the area and is great for any outdoor activity.

SEA LIFE Kansas City.

Sea Life Kansas City can be found in Kansas City Missouri. This interactive aquarium houses thousands of aquatic creatures. The aquarium has a 360-degree underwater tunnel and touch pools. Merlin Entertainments is the owner of the attraction. Sea Life Kansas City is the perfect place to spend a family day.

Crown Center's Aquarium offers interactive talks during the day. Parking is available on-site and admission is free. The Crown Center Parking Garage is also available for guests. This facility can also issue parking tickets. There are many restaurants in the Crown Center District, so it is easy to find something to eat and drink after visiting an aquarium.

The SEA LIFE Kansas City Aquarium has over 30 exhibits that feature thousands of tropical fish. The aquarium also has sharks and rays. There are interactive exhibits available for children, including the Doodle Reef, which allows you to create a virtual marine creature and then print it.

SEA LIFE Kansas City offers a family-friendly educational experience. The aquarium houses 5,000 animals, which include many species of fish and other living creatures.
